/admin/luke can give you a lastModified time stamp.  The Solr admin UI makes a 
request to display this on the core overview screen, making a request like 
this:  
http://localhost:8983/solr/<core>/admin/luke?wt=json&show=index&numTerms=0 
<http://localhost:8983/solr/%3Ccore%3E/admin/luke?wt=json&show=index&numTerms=0>

and the index section of the response has this:  
lastModified: "2015-09-03T15:17:22.708Z"
